Shopian set to host Dubjan winter carnival tomorrow

Srinagar, Feb 14: Shopian is all set to host the second edition of the much-anticipated Winter Carnival at Dubjan Meadow on Monday.
According to the details available, the event is being organized by the Tourism Department in collaboration with the Shopian administration.
It aims to boost winter tourism in the region by highlighting the natural beauty and rich cultural heritage of South Kashmir. Surrounded by snow-covered landscapes, Dubjan is expected to transform into a vibrant hub of celebration, adventure, and tradition for the day-long carnival.
An Official of the Tourism Department said that the carnival will offer a wide range of attractions including snow activities, fun-filled snow games, colourful cultural performances, traditional Kashmiri music, local cuisine stalls, departmental exhibitions, and various recreational events.
“The objective is not only to attract tourists during the winter season but also to create livelihood opportunities for local artists, artisans and vendors,” he said. “Dubjan has immense tourism potential, especially in winter, and such initiatives help put it on the tourism map,” the official added.
Locals are eagerly awaiting the festival, calling it a much-needed push for the area’s economy.
“We are very happy that the government is focusing on Dubjan. During winters, business usually slows down, but such carnivals bring visitors and help us earn,” said Ghulam Hassan, a tea stall owner from a nearby village.
Another resident, Farooq Ahmad, who runs a small handicraft shop, said the carnival provides a rare platform for locals to showcase their products. “Tourists love our handmade items and local food. Events like this help preserve our culture while supporting our families,” he added.
Young residents are equally excited about the snow sports and cultural programs. “We usually travel far to enjoy winter festivals. Having one here in Shopian is special and will attract people from other districts too,” said college student Aijaz Ahmad.
The district administration has assured adequate arrangements regarding safety, traffic management, and basic facilities to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ience for visitors.
With scenic snowfall, cultural vibrancy, and community participation, the Dubjan Winter Carnival is expected to emerge as a signature winter tourism event in Shopian, strengthening the region’s growing reputation as a year-round tourist destination.
